 has a mandatory start date scheduled for July 28, 2001; the 323 NPA has a mandatory start date scheduled for August 25, 2001; and the 925 NPA has a mandatory start date scheduled for September 29, 2001. The 916 and 925 NPAs will affect parts of northern California, and the 323 NPA will affect a portion of southern California outside of Los Angeles.

The Telcordia Center for Number Pooling Administration (TCNPA) includes a state of the art system that allows for online applications, data validation and reports during the pooling trial. The center is supported by the technical and software development experts of Telcordia. Carriers were formerly assigned phone numbers in blocks of 10,000 on a rate center basis, which would potentially strand large quantities of numbers and cause a shortage of central office codes and area codes. Telcordia Technologies, known in the industry for its numbering administration expertise, has participated in the development of industry guidelines for thousands-block number pooling administration and implementation of telecommunications initiatives. In addition, Telcordia served for 14 years as the impartial administrator of NANP, provides the software for numbering administration in Canada, and continues to play a leading role in industry forums addressing key numbering issues, and policies.

On February 9, 2001 the Assigned Commissioner of the CPUC issued a Ruling Regarding Number Pooling Implementation for 2001 in Rulemaking 95-04-043 and Investigation 95-04-044 announcing Telcordia as Pooling Administrator for the mandatory trial in the 916, 323 and 925 NPAs and setting an implementation schedule.
